软考系统架构师教材2024(软考系统架构师2024教材)
软考系统架构师教材2024

2024年软考系统架构师教材的发布,标志着我国信息技术人才评价体系在系统架构设计与实施方面迈出了重要一步。该教材以“系统架构设计”为核心,融合了当前信息技术发展的前沿趋势,如云计算、人工智能、大数据与物联网等,旨在培养具备系统思维、架构设计能力及技术实践能力的高级IT人才。教材结构清晰,内容全面,覆盖系统架构设计原则、技术选型、架构风格、系统生命周期管理、安全与可靠性等多个维度,充分体现了系统架构师在复杂系统开发中的关键作用。
教材采用模块化设计,内容深入浅出,适合不同层次的学习者。其中,系统架构设计原则部分,强调了架构的可扩展性、可维护性、可替换性、可演化性等核心要素,为学习者提供了系统化的设计思维框架。技术选型部分则结合了当前主流技术栈,如微服务、容器化、分布式系统等,帮助学习者掌握实际开发中的技术选择策略。
2024年教材在内容深度和广度上均有提升,尤其在系统架构的演化与管理方面,更加注重架构的动态调整与优化。
除了这些以外呢,教材还强化了安全与可靠性设计,在系统架构设计中融入了数据加密、访问控制、容灾备份等关键技术,体现了系统架构师在保障系统安全与稳定方面的责任与使命。
,2024年软考系统架构师教材在内容结构、技术深度、实践导向等方面均表现出较高的专业性与实用性,为学习者提供了全面、系统的知识体系,也进一步推动了我国系统架构师人才的培养与行业发展。
系统架构师教材2024学习攻略
学习系统架构师教材2024,需要从基础到深入,逐步构建系统化的知识体系。
下面呢为具体的学习策略与建议。
一、系统架构设计基础
系统架构设计是系统架构师的核心能力,学习者应从基础开始,掌握系统架构的基本概念与设计原则。
1.系统架构设计原则
系统架构设计需遵循以下原则:
- 可扩展性:系统应具备良好的扩展能力,能够适应在以后业务增长和技术演进。
- 可维护性:系统设计应便于维护与更新,降低后期维护成本。
- 可替换性:系统组件应具备可替换性,便于替换为更优的技术方案。
- 可演化性:系统架构应具备演化能力,能够适应不断变化的需求。
这些原则为架构设计提供了指导,学习者应结合实际项目进行练习,逐步掌握架构设计的思维。
2.架构风格与模式
系统架构设计中,常见的架构风格包括:
- 分层架构:将系统划分为多个层次,如表现层、业务层、数据层等。
- 微服务架构:将系统拆分为多个独立的服务,提高灵活性与可扩展性。
- 事件驱动架构:基于事件驱动的设计模式,适用于实时系统与高并发场景。
学习者应了解不同架构风格的优缺点,结合项目需求选择合适的架构模式。
二、系统架构设计实践
理论学习是基础,实践是关键。学习者应通过实际项目进行架构设计,并结合教材内容进行深入理解。
1.技术选型与架构设计
在技术选型时,需考虑以下因素:
- 性能需求:根据系统规模与并发量选择合适的技术栈。
- 安全性需求:确保系统数据与服务的安全性。
- 可维护性与可扩展性:选择可维护、可扩展的技术方案。
- 成本与资源限制:在预算与资源有限的情况下,选择性价比高的技术方案。
例如,对于高并发的电商系统,可采用微服务架构,结合容器化技术(如Docker、Kubernetes)进行部署,确保系统的灵活性与可扩展性。
2.架构设计与评审
架构设计完成后,需进行评审,确保设计合理、可行。
- 架构评审:由架构师、技术专家及业务人员共同评审架构设计。
- 架构文档:编写详细的架构设计文档,包括系统分解、技术选型、部署方案等。
- 架构演进:根据业务变化,定期评估与调整架构设计。
架构评审与文档是确保架构设计质量的重要环节,学习者应积极参与并掌握相关方法。
三、系统架构设计案例分析
通过案例分析,学习者可以更好地理解系统架构设计的实际应用。
1.电商平台架构设计
电商平台涉及用户、商品、订单、支付等多个业务模块,架构设计需考虑系统的可扩展性与稳定性。
- 技术选型:采用微服务架构,使用Spring Cloud作为框架,结合Kubernetes进行容器化部署。
- 架构模式:采用分层架构,分为表现层、业务层与数据层。
- 安全设计:采用OAuth2.0进行身份认证,使用AES加密数据传输。
通过该案例,学习者可以了解如何在实际项目中应用系统架构设计原则与技术选型。
2.金融系统架构设计
金融系统对安全性与稳定性要求极高,架构设计需兼顾安全与性能。
- 技术选型:采用分布式架构,使用Apache Kafka进行消息队列,使用Redis进行缓存。
- 架构模式:采用事件驱动架构,确保系统响应速度快。
- 安全设计:采用多因素认证与加密通信,确保数据安全。
该案例展示了系统架构设计在高安全要求场景下的应用。
四、系统架构师学习建议
学习系统架构师教材2024,需结合自身实际情况制定学习计划,确保学习效率。
1.制定学习计划
建议将学习分为基础、进阶与实战三个阶段,逐步深入。
- 基础阶段:掌握系统架构设计基本概念与原则。
- 进阶阶段:学习架构设计模式与技术选型。
- 实战阶段:通过实际项目进行架构设计与优化。
制定合理的学习计划,有助于提高学习效率。
2.多维度学习
学习不仅限于教材,还可参考行业报告、技术博客、开源项目等资源。
- 行业报告:了解行业最新趋势与技术发展。
- 技术博客:阅读技术博客,获取最新的架构设计思路。
- 开源项目:通过开源项目学习架构设计的实际应用。
多维度学习有助于提升学习效果。
3.实践与归结起来说
学习过程中,应注重实践与归结起来说,将所学知识应用到实际项目中,并不断归结起来说经验。
- 项目实践:参与实际项目,进行架构设计与优化。
- 经验归结起来说:定期归结起来说学习经验,形成自己的架构设计思路。
实践与归结起来说是提升架构设计能力的重要途径。
五、归结起来说
2024年软考系统架构师教材在内容深度与广度上均有提升,为学习者提供了全面、系统的知识体系。学习系统架构师教材2024,需从基础到深入,逐步构建系统化的知识体系,结合实际项目进行实践与归结起来说。
通过系统架构设计原则、架构风格、技术选型与架构评审等环节,学习者可以掌握系统架构设计的核心能力。
于此同时呢,通过案例分析与实践,提升架构设计的实际应用能力。

阿斌号jilihua.cn作为软考系统架构师教材2024的学习平台,致力于提供高质量、系统化的学习资源,帮助学习者高效掌握系统架构师知识,助力职业发展。通过系统化的学习路径与丰富的学习资源,阿斌号jilihua.cn将成为学习者实现职业目标的重要助力。